Enhanced Benefit Booster
In 2026, the Benefit Booster is being elevated to deliver even greater value, centred around simplicity and member wellbeing.
• The previous tiered structure has been removed.
• Members must now complete a wellness screening via our preferred partner channel to assess their health risk.
• An online mental health assessment is also required to unlock the Benefit Booster, enabling early identification of mental health concerns and timely support, without stigma or prejudice.
• As an added bonus, the Benefit Booster on Primary and BonPrime has been increased by 5.3 %, now offering R4 000 in 2026.
To support this initiative, we’ ve worked closely with our wellness screening providers to enhance referral protocols, ensuring members receive immediate mental health support and reducing the risk of hospitalisation.
Mental health consultation benefits have been adjusted as follows:
• Primary: R9 780
• BonSave: R15 440
• BonPrime: Paid from savings
Chronic & disease management enhancements
Bonitas continues to expand access to care through strategic benefit enhancements:
• Benign Prostate Hyperplasia has been added as a chronic condition on BonComprehensive, offering members broader access to treatment

• For members with diabetes, the insulin pump and continuous glucose monitoring device benefit has been unbundled, allowing claims for one insulin pump every five years, one continuous glucose monitor every year and consumables, enhancing flexibility and quality of care.
• As part of our strategic realignment, we have recalibrated our chronic and acute medicine formularies at an option level. Members will continue to enjoy access to the same categories of medicine with adjustments made to improve treatment outcomes and deploy more strategic generic selections.
Hospital network optimisation
Hospital negotiations have been a strategic enabler for the Scheme, generating annual savings of over R400 million. This allows Bonitas to keep contribution increases lower while securing the best possible rates for members. Bonitas has engaged all major hospital groups to define new networks for the next three years, with a strong focus on maintaining the footprint and size of existing networks.
• The current Bonitas hospital networks will remain in place until the end of 2025
• The updated networks were announced in October 2025 and will impact the following options: BonClassic, BonComplete, BonSave, BonPrime, BonFit, Primary, Standard Select, BonStart, BonStart Plus, BonEssential Select, Hospital Standard, BonCap
• The BonEssential network will be aligned with Primary, offering a broader hospital selection than BonEssential Select
